Bluegrass Camp Meeting

Bluegrass Camp Meeting Traditional / Arr. James Red McLeod

Bluegrass Camp Meeting is one of hundreds of pieces originating bad'i to the early settlers who populated mountain areas stretching from Pennsylvania to Georgia. They brought with them their folk-songs, ballads and dances from England and Scotland and played them in a style which has remained very much the same for over 200 years. This light instrumental piece probably originated in the Blue Ridge Mountains of Virginia. It is a virtuosic tune for fiddlers which is the tradition of bluegrass style.
